Is a Smart Radiator Thermostat Worth It?
When considering a smart radiator thermostat, many people ask whether it’s worth the price. After all, thermostatic radiator valves (TRVs) have been around for years, and they work just fine, right? While it’s true that traditional TRVs do a decent job of controlling temperature, they don’t offer the same level of flexibility and convenience as smart models. A smart radiator thermostat, such as those from brands like Danfoss or Tado, can be programmed to adjust the temperature automatically based on your daily schedule, occupancy, and even the weather.
For businesses and homeowners alike, the main benefit of smart thermostatic radiator valves is energy savings. Smart TRVs can optimize heating and reduce wasted energy by only heating rooms when they are in use. This ensures that energy isn’t being wasted in rooms that are empty or not in need of heating, ultimately lowering your energy bills.
Moreover, smart TRVs are a great way to ensure a comfortable environment. If you have different preferences for different rooms or zones, smart TRVs can be programmed to maintain various temperatures for each area. This flexibility can be especially useful in a multi-room house or commercial space.
All in all, the convenience and energy-saving benefits make smart thermostatic radiator valves a worthwhile investment for many.

What is the Problem with Thermostatic Radiator Valves?
Thermostatic radiator valves (TRVs) are designed to regulate the temperature of radiators by automatically adjusting the flow of water based on the room’s temperature. However, they come with a few drawbacks. One common issue with traditional TRVs is that they can be quite slow in reacting to changes in room temperature. This means they may take a while to reach the desired temperature, which can be inconvenient, especially in larger spaces.
Another issue is that standard TRVs do not offer much in terms of customization. They tend to operate on a simple dial that allows users to set the desired temperature but lacks the ability to adjust settings for specific schedules or zones. This lack of flexibility can result in higher energy consumption because the system may not always be heating rooms efficiently.
Furthermore, low-quality TRVs may have issues with stability and performance, leading to inconsistent temperature control and increased energy bills. For businesses or homeowners who rely on heating systems to maintain comfort, these inconsistencies can be frustrating and costly.

What is the Life Expectancy of a Thermostatic Valve?
The life expectancy of a thermostatic valve depends on a few factors, including the quality of the valve, the level of usage, and how well it’s maintained. On average, a high-quality thermostatic radiator valve can last anywhere between 10 to 20 years with proper maintenance.
Regular servicing and proper installation can help prolong the lifespan of your TRVs. Cleaning the valve regularly and ensuring that it’s not exposed to extreme conditions or harsh chemicals can also increase its longevity. Moreover, using high-quality valves, such as the angled thermostatic radiator valve, can further ensure a longer operational life.
For businesses or homes that rely on heating systems for comfort and productivity, investing in durable and long-lasting thermostatic radiator valves is essential. The longer the life expectancy, the less likely you’ll need to replace them frequently, which translates into cost savings over time.
